Omarion Vents About Grammys Snub: ‘The odds have always been against me.’
On Monday, the Grammys were announced and Omarion’s name was missing in action. The singer and Love & Hip Hop Hollywood star (by the way, we hear he won’t be returning next season), took to Twitter sharing his thoughts. He writes:
“Post to be” is one of the greatest R&B collaborations ever. CB, Jhene, & myself been in the game 10+.
— OMARION (@1Omarion) December 7, 2015
Even though people act like its easy to make a hit (& it’s not). As an artist you look forward to being acknowledged by the game.
— OMARION (@1Omarion) December 7, 2015
The odds have always been against me. I constantly prove you wrong. I’ll consistently do great things & you will have to celebrate me.
— OMARION (@1Omarion) December 7, 2015
